According to the Centers for Disease Control and Prevention, more than 2 in 5 adults in the United States have prediabetes , a condition where blood glucose levels are higher than they should be, but not as high as in type 2 diabetes . Risk factors for developing prediabetes include having overweight or obesity, being at least 45 years old, having a close relative with type 2 diabetes, having ever had gestational (pregnancy) diabetes, or given birth to a baby weighing more than 9lbs (4kg). People with prediabetes are at risk of developing a number of chronic health conditions, as well as progressing to type 2 diabetes, and often end up with multimorbidity — having 2 or more chronic conditions. A number of lifestyle changes, including losing weight, being more physically active, and adopting a healthier diet, can help prevent this. If these changes do not lower blood glucose, clinicians may prescribe the type 2 diabetes drug metformin .

However, a study published in JAMA has shown that lifestyle modifications may be more effective than metformin for pr eventing multimorbidity in people with prediabetes.
“This is a very important finding because it shifts the conversation from preventing a single disease to promoting long-term health across multiple organ systems. The study showed that lifestyle intervention not only reduced progression to diabetes but also lowered the risk of developing multiple chronic conditions over more than two decades of follow-up. That is particularly meaningful given the growing burden of multimorbidity in aging populations.”
– Thomas M. Holland , Physician Scientist and Assistant Professor, Department of Internal Medicine, RUSH Institute for Healthy Aging, Chicago, who was not involved in the study.

Multimorbidity has been estimated to affect up to 95% of the primary care population aged 65 years and older, and the risk is increased in people with prediabetes.

The researchers carried out a 21-year observational study using data from participants in the Diabetes Prevention Program (DPP) and DPP Outcomes studies (DPPOS). The 1,173 people analyzed were randomly allocated to a lifestyle intervention, metformin, or placebo.

The metformin group took 850mg metformin twice daily, and the placebo group took an identical dummy tablet twice daily. Both these groups were also offered lifestyle advice sessions 4 times a year.
At the beginning of the 21 years, the participants had a median age of 51 years, and a median BMI of 32.1 (having obesity). The majority, 56%, were non-Hispanic white, with almost a quarter non-Hispanic Black, and the rest Hispanic, Asian/Pacific Islander, and Native American.
At the end of follow-up, 85% of participants had multimorbidity, with the most common conditions being hyperlipidemia (high cholesterol, 76%), hypertension (high blood pressure, 75%), and diabetes (67%).
However, the number of chronic conditions differed between groups. In the placebo and metformin groups, participants had a median of 5 chronic conditions, whereas in the lifestyle group, the median was 4.
In total, 82% of the lifestyle group, 85% of the metformin group, and 87% of the placebo group had 2 or more chronic conditions.
However, while 81% of both the placebo and metformin groups had more than 3 chronic conditions, just 72% of the lifestyle group did.
